    Hiram Collins Haydn (November 3, 1907 – December 2, 1973) [1] was an American writer and editor. He was editor in chief at Random House before leaving to help establish Atheneum Publishing. [2] He was also the editor of Phi Beta Kappa 's literary journal, The American Scholar, from 1944 to 1973. [3]

    Published. April 1979 – 2006. Bunnicula is a children's novel series. The first installment was written by James and Deborah Howe, and introduced a vampire rabbit named Bunnicula who sucks the juice out of vegetables. [1] After the sudden death of his wife in June 1978, months before the first book saw print, Howe continued the project alone.
